Reinforced staple line in severely emphysematous lungs
F M Juettner1, P Kohek, H Pinter
1Department of Thoracic and Hyperbaric Surgery, University Medical School of Graz, Austria.
The Journal of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ery
|March 1, 1989
Abstract:
In severely emphysematous or otherwise destroyed lung parenchyma, staples often cut through, which causes prolonged postoperative air leakage. A mechanical suture line reinforced by a polydioxanone ribbon is a simple, safe, and effective method for closure of air leaks, resection, or biopsy in such cases.
